@@ -934,6 +942,24 @@ int analog_call(struct analog_pvt *p, struct ast_channel *ast, char *rdest, int
ast_setstate(ast, AST_STATE_RINGING);
index = analog_get_index(ast, p, 0);
if (index > -1) {
+ struct ast_cc_config_params *cc_params;
+
+ /* This is where the initial ringing frame is queued for an analog call.
+ * As such, this is a great time to offer CCNR to the caller if it's available.
+ */
+ cc_params = ast_channel_get_cc_config_params(p->subs[index].owner);
+ if (cc_params) {
+ switch (ast_get_cc_monitor_policy(cc_params)) {
+ case AST_CC_MONITOR_NEVER:
+ break;
+ case AST_CC_MONITOR_NATIVE:
+ case AST_CC_MONITOR_ALWAYS:
+ case AST_CC_MONITOR_GENERIC:
+ ast_queue_cc_frame(p->subs[index].owner, AST_CC_GENERIC_MONITOR_TYPE,
+ analog_get_orig_dialstring(p), AST_CC_CCNR, NULL);
+ break;
+ }
+ }
ast_queue_control(p->subs[index].owner, AST_CONTROL_RINGING);
}
break;
